Observational Study of Pyloric Sphincter Abnormalities in Gastroparesis
This study is looking at whether people with gastroparesis symptoms have problems with their pyloric sphincter (the muscle that controls food leaving the stomach). Researchers want to see how common these problems are using special tests like the Endoflip™ (which measures the size and flexibility of the sphincter), water load satiety testing (WLST), and high-resolution cutaneous electrogastrography (HR-EGG) using the Gastric Alimetry™ System. The main goal is to measure the flexibility of the pylorus at the beginning of the study. You might be able to join if you are between 18 and 85 years old and have symptoms of gastroparesis, whether it's related to diabetes or has no known cause. - Study design
- This is an observational study planning to include 150 participants. It will compare people with gastroparesis symptoms to those without.
- What's involved
- The study will assess your lower esophageal and pyloric sphincter using an Endoflip™ catheter, a water load satiety test, and the Gastric Alimetry™ System.

What this trial measures
- Distensibility of the pylorusBaseline
Distensibility of the pylorus will be calculated as the median of three measurements (not three different inflations) of distensibility (mm2/mmHg) of the pylorus pressure using the Endoflip balloon catheter at 50 mL volume
